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60541312823 3251700 8020293840 59 1887
68111624 328276 93675
68111624 328276 93675
7573 4706606837 455815 808655
All about undefined
Interested in learning more?
68111624 328276 93675
7573 4706606837 455815 808655
See more
97215349 472528
032334948 5809 31119465043
See more
91 78035344883 32569830
795 5229 32 83
See more